You will be responsible for monitoring and following up on clinical studies at assigned investigator sites, ensuring compliance with the protocol, Good Clinical Practices (GCP), and regulatory requirements. Your main responsibilities will include: Conducting study initiation, monitoring (on-site and remote), and close-out visits. Verifying the quality and accuracy of clinical data and the correct management of informed consent. Overseeing adverse event reporting and ensuring ethical and regulatory compliance. Keeping study documentation up to date and preparing visit reports. Providing ongoing support to investigators to ensure proper patient recruitment and follow-up. What are we looking for? University degree in health sciences, biology, pharmacy, medicine, or related fields. Previous experience as a Clinical Research Associate or in clinical research (experience in observational or clinical studies is highly valued). Good knowledge of Good Clinical Practices (GCP) and applicable regulations. Str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and a focus on data quality. Good communication skills, autonomy, and the ability to manage multiple sites and tasks.
